She's alleging that in 2015 Biden pressured the Ukraine Govt to fire a prosecutor who was investigating an energy company that had Hunter Biden as a board member
It's true that the Vice--president did put pressure on Ukraine to replace Viktor Shokin as their chief prosecutor; the reasons might be just a little different from those she presumably believes.
As I understood it at the time, Biden pressured the Ukraine government (on the instructions of his own government, and at the request of the European Union, the World Bank and the International Monetary Fund) to replace Viktor Shokin precisely because he wasn't investigating Burisma, or anything much else in the way of corruption, because he was himself both corrupt and ineffective.
